About

Rodolfo Mariano is a scholar working on Ecology,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ics and Nature and Landscape Conservation. According to data from OpenAlex, Rodolfo Mariano has authored 37 papers receiving a total of 201 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 32 papers in Ecology, 21 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ics and 16 papers in Nature and Landscape Conservation. Recurrent topics in Rodolfo Mariano’s work include Freshwater macroinvertebrate diversity and ecology (28 papers), Invertebrate Taxonomy and Ecology (14 papers) and Fish Ecology and Management Studies (14 papers). Rodolfo Mariano is often cited by papers focused on Freshwater macroinvertebrate diversity and ecology (28 papers), Invertebrate Taxonomy and Ecology (14 papers) and Fish Ecology and Management Studies (14 papers). Rodolfo Mariano collaborates with scholars based in Brazil, Argentina and United States. Rodolfo Mariano's co-authors include Adolfo R. Calor, Eduardo Domı́nguez, Carlos Molineri, Frederico Falcão Salles, Ulisses dos Santos Pinheiro, Lucas Ramos Costa Lima, Roberta Paresque, Luiz Carlos Pinho, Cláudio G. Froehlich and Jeane Marcelle Cavalcante do Nascimento and has published in prestigious journals such as Environmental Monitoring and Assessment, Zoological Journal of the Linnean Society and Zootaxa.
